It's very important to learn what went wrong in the interview. If the interviewer gives a feedback on what you have improve ,focus on those gaps and prepare for the next interview Don't repeat the same mistake Understand why you were not able to crack the interview , identify the missing piece which couldn't get you cleared Practice ,learn those things which missed It's important to identify what was not working ,untill you understand what is wrong it'll be difficult to crack the interview as you'll be repeating same mistakes So as you fill the missing pieces ,you'll surely do we'll and one fine day you'll get the offer Don't loose the hope , preperation and hardwork will be definitely paid of one day Just keep trying ,don't loose your confidence keep focusing on your skills ace them and you'll get the confidence for sure All the best!! read less
